UI DESIGN LAB
  • 首页
  • 社区
  • 资源库
  • 知识库
  • 文档
EN登录
返回知识库
Interaction Responsive Motion

拖拽替代控件

拖拽替代控件把一个高频界面判断转成可执行约束,帮助 Agent 在生成前做出更具体的布局、交互或可访问性选择。

drag-dropaccessibilitycontrols

设计原则

拖拽适合直接操作,但排序、移动和上传必须有非拖拽路径。

原则 拖拽适合直接操作,但排序、移动和上传必须有非拖拽路径。

设计动作 为拖拽提供按钮、菜单或键盘移动;拖拽过程中显示目标区、顺序变化和完成反馈。

正反例 正向示例:看板、列表排序、文件上传、布局编辑器和组件编排需要直接移动对象。 反向示例:唯一操作路径是拖拽。

适用场景 看板、列表排序、文件上传、布局编辑器和组件编排需要直接移动对象。 用户需要快速判断状态、范围、风险或下一步行动。

来源提示 来源提示:综合 Apple HIG、Material Design、GOV.UK/Polaris/Atlassian 组件实践和交互可访问性原则整理。

Agent 指令

为拖拽提供按钮、菜单或键盘移动;拖拽过程中显示目标区、顺序变化和完成反馈。

适用场景

  • 看板、列表排序、文件上传、布局编辑器和组件编排需要直接移动对象。
  • 用户需要快速判断状态、范围、风险或下一步行动。

避免做法

  • 唯一操作路径是拖拽。
  • 为了视觉丰富而加入无关结构、文案或装饰。

知识元数据

分类
Interaction Responsive Motion
质量分
86%
版本
v1
发布
2026/6/6